This workshop is a 5-day intensive – 6 hours each day of instruction and one and one-half hour break for lunch (not included).
Students will focus on how thinking outside the box with their sculptural work, from playful and possibly kinetic critters to nests, movable botanicals, and more. My goal as an instructor will be to challenge you to take your work one step further in a playful manner. Demonstrations will include hidden kinetic connections, fusing, carving, forming with hammers and stakes, and more. Students will create several pieces during this intensive workshop.
Five-day intensives give students an understanding of what is involved to work full-time as a silversmith.

Please note that I do not give students specific projects to complete. I offer many different demonstrations throughout the day, so you’re welcome to copy my demonstrations or take the techniques to incorporate into your own designs. I encourage you to explore your own artistic expression.
Course Prerequisites include:
It is preferred that you are at an intermediate level as a silversmith, with experience using the Little Smith oxygen/propane torch.
